              In late 2015, when Canelo had not fought at the full 160lb limit yet and GGG was drooling for 154 fighters to come up and fight him, Canelo turned down GGG at the full 160, citing he is not a MW yet.

              This is why initially, in 2015, he told GGG he would only fight him at 155lbs.

              Now yes, 155lbs is technically MW, but Canelo was not ready to fight at the full limit. The fight ended up happening in 2017 at the full 160 limit after Canelo felt comfortable beating a terrible fighter in JCC Jr at 164lbs. He thought since he felt good at 164, he is ready to fight the best at 160lbs. He was confident. This is why his first fighter at the full MW limit was GGG.
